As another long NBA season winds down, it is exciting to see so many teams playing at such a high level. The Utah Jazz did get beaten by the Lakers, but that was a more important game for LA and Kobe Bryant led his squad to a statement win.

The statement is that the Lakers are not ready to give up the West just yet.

This is the deepest the West has looked in the last few seasons and the West has looked deep for the past few seasons. It looks like every playoff team in the West will have 50 wins so every round could be a battle for the team who wins the West.

The Lakers, as the one seed, look to be the favorite still but Dallas, Utah, Phoenix, Oklahoma City and San Antonio are all peaking at the right time.

Denver is struggling with injuries and that is a shame for the team that looked poised to make a run only a month ago. Portland even making the playoffs is very impressive as they have dealt with injuries all year long.

The East looks like a two-team race with Cleveland and Orlando headed for an Eastern Conference Finals re-match.
